We’re seeking a talented and curious Technical Product Manager to join our global Platform team, which sits at the centre of our SaaS transformation for our insurance technology business. You will work across every part of our technology business to solve problems spanning our whole product portfolio in delivering market-leading SaaS solutions to our insurance clients. This is a unique opportunity to get exposure to a wide variety of business problems, products and stakeholders. The role requires someone who has both deep technical expertise and strong product management experience to lead a development team supporting one or more Platform services.

The Role

  • Own the product vision, strategy and roadmap for one or more Platform services.
  • Socializing the vision and strategy with the business and managing expectations on the scope with stakeholders.
  • Defining and prioritizing business level outcomes/problems to solve (and what's out of scope)
  • Responsible for ensuring solutions are viable for the business and meet end user needs.
  • Defining and tracking product metrics, return on investment and the business case for one or more Platform services.
  • Elicit and capture user and business requirements across our technology teams.
  • Combine qualitative and quantitative insights to support prioritisation and product decisions.
  • Adopt a test and learn approach to validate assumptions early and increase confidence in the value we are delivering to the business and our clients.
  • Support solution design, technical decisions and release management for one or more Platform services.
  • Accountable for the adoption and go-to-market plan for one or more Platform services.
  • Create clear and effective documentation.
  • Prioritise delivery trade-offs, technical debt and cost/efficiency decisions.
  • Regularly communicate product and delivery updates and evangelise Platform to other teams in the business.
  • Manage the backlog, sprint goals and problem breakdown within the team.
  • Mentor and coach product management within the team and promote technical excellence.

What you’ll bring

  • Ability to work as part of a team using both agentic and human-led software development approaches, curating product context and setting acceptance criteria at engineering depth.
  • Outcome-focused product management experience with Public Cloud and Software-as-a-Service solutions.
  • Strong technical experience, ideally with tools or technologies that are common services consumed by engineering teams.
  • Experience solving multiple and complex problems with teams.
  • Ability to distill complex topics into non-technical and simple communications.
  • Strong interpersonal and communication skills.
  • Able to manage, align and influence multiple stakeholders of varying levels of seniority.
  • Data and insight driven with the ability to map delivery back to measured business impact.

Other highly desirable, but not essential skills are

  • Knowledge of Azure Cloud services
  • Experience of using AI capabilities to accelerate product and delivery processes.
  • Previous experience managing platform services
  • General knowledge of the Insurance Industry
  • Degree-educated with Computer Science, Engineering, Mathematics or relevant discipline
